The prescription process for anticoagulants, similar to Eliquis, begins with an initial assessment by a healthcare supplier. This evaluation sometimes features a thorough medical history, analysis of the affected person's risk elements for thromboembolic events, and a evaluate of any current medicines which will interact with anticoagulants. Laboratory exams, similar to renal operate checks and coagulation profiles, may be performed to ensure the affected person is an appropriate candidate for anticoagulation remedy.

During the initial evaluation, the healthcare provider will think about the patient's specific situation, similar to atrial fibrillation or venous thromboembolism, to determine the suitable anticoagulant and dosage. Patient training is crucial at this stage, as individuals should perceive the significance of adherence to the medication regimen and be conscious of potential side effects and signs of bleeding. The supplier may even focus on the necessity for regular follow-up appointments to monitor the affected person's response to therapy and make any essential adjustments.

Recognizing unwanted effects is a important facet of patient training, significantly for these on anticoagulants, where the chance of bleeding is a major concern. Sufferers must be informed about widespread indicators of adverse reactions, corresponding to unusual bruising, extended bleeding from cuts, or blood in urine or stool. By being vigilant and informed, sufferers can promptly search medical consideration in the occasion that they expertise any regarding symptoms, thereby enhancing their safety and the effectiveness of their treatment.
